The phrase "accelerating the uptake of"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the process of increasing the adoption or acceptance of something, such as a technology, idea, or practice.
Example: "The new marketing strategy is focused on accelerating the uptake of renewable energy solutions among consumers."
Alternatives: "speeding up the adoption of" or "enhancing the acceptance of".
